Sahiyo announces the Healing as Activism Campaign

During this 16 Days of Activism Against Gender Based Violence from November 25th to December 10th, Sahiyo will be hosting Healing as Activism, a public awareness campaign that uplifts healing as an important form of activism and seeks to break the stigma surrounding discussions of mental health, which often impacts survivors' ability to heal. While the physical health of a female genital cutting (FGC) survivor is often highlighted, it is important not to forget about the lasting mental and emotional impacts this harmful practice can have on survivors as well. During the campaign, we’ll amplify stories of healing from those impacted by FGC.
